Join us as Rochelle Pennington shares the story about one of the most well-known shipwrecks of the Great Lakes – Lake Michigan’s Christmas Tree Ship. This festive ship delivered holiday evergreens to the citizens of Chicago each Christmas season before it was caught in the “Great Storm of 1912” and subsequently sank to the bottom of the lake fully loaded with trees. Learn about the ship’s mysterious disappearance, clues that washed ashore in the decades following the vessel’s demise, ghost ship sightings of the phantom schooner, and mysterious omens believed to have cursed the ship before it set sail on its final voyage on November 22, 1912. The captain’s wife, Barbara, along with their three daughters, carried on for over 20 years afterward in honor of “Captain Santa” and in the spirit of everything he believed in. The ship is still loaded with its cargo today and is a popular Great Lakes dive site.
